Because for Uruguay he was asked to play out wide and be a workhorse? Added to that he's relished having the direct, width-based attacking game that Napoli have used with plenty of support to find his runs from more central positions, and none of this is the case with Uruguay. They're all about being compact and keeping it tight in the midfield, sorely lacking creativity outside of Forlan.
